A type of chain or necklace, particularly one made of woven or braided material used in jewelry or as a decorative ornament.
From Latin 'catena' (chain), possibly influenced by Spanish and Italian forms. The term evolved to describe ornamental neck chains worn across various Mediterranean cultures.
Chalinas appear in artwork from ancient civilizations and represent an elegant way to display status and wealth before modern jewelry-making techniques existed.
